Small and medium enterprises (SMEs) otak-otak of
milkfish have an important role as one of the drivers of the economy of Gresik Regency, because it can help in the absorption of labor and poverty alleviation efforts. On the other side, small and medium enterprises (SMEs) otak-otak of milkfish in Gresik Regency have many problems faced, such as: capital, marketing, the product cannot last long, the production process is still manual. The purpose of this research was to identify the characteristics otak-otak of milkfish in Gresik Regency in order to find out the actual description or condition faced by these SME entrepreneurs. After getting an overview or actual condition, an analysis of the internal and external environmental conditions otak-otak of milkfish and
the selection of several alternative development strategies are carried out. The strategy used in developing SMEs otak-otak of milkfish is by conducting market penetration, market development, and product development.
